#f2e252 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f2e252 is composed of 94.9% red, 88.6%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 6.6% magenta, 66.1%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 54 degrees, a saturation of 86% and a lightness of 63.5%. #f2e252 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ffa4 with #e5c500.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c66.

Shades and Tints of #f2e252

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090901 is the darkest color, while #fefef6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f2e252

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a3a3a1 is the less saturated color, while #f9e84b is the most saturated one.
